Buddy Holly’s brother ( NOTE: Larry Holley, the eldest of the four Holley children, died in Lubbock on April 7, 2022, aged 96. He was survived by two children, three granddaughters and four great-grandchildren.

Dec 2, 2016 · LUBBOCK, TX (KCBD) - Travis Holley, brother of legendary Buddy Holly, passed away Thursday night around 6:30 p.m., according to relatives. Holley was 89 years old. His daughter, Travetta Johnson, posted her father's passing along with a photo of him and his brother, Larry, on her Facebook page.
